dotConnect for PostgreSQL Documentation
Devart.Data.PostgreSql Namespace / PgSqlDataReader Class / GetDouble Method / GetDouble(Int32) Method
Example

GetDouble(Int32) Method
Gets the value of the specified column as a double-precision floating point number.
Syntax
'Declaration
 
Public Overloads Overrides Function GetDouble( _
   ByVal i As Integer _
) As Double
 

Parameters

i

Return Value

The value of the specified column.
Remarks

Call IsDBNull to check for null values before calling this method.

Example
static void GetMyDouble(PgSqlConnection myConnection) {
  PgSqlCommand cmd = new PgSqlCommand("SELECT * FROM Test.AllTypes");
  cmd.Connection = myConnection;
  myConnection.Open();
  try {
    PgSqlDataReader reader = cmd.ExecuteReader();
    reader.Read();
    double recievedDouble = reader.GetDouble(reader.GetOrdinal("DoubleCol"));
    reader.Close();
  }
  finally {
    myConnection.Close();
  }
}
Shared Sub GetMyDouble(ByVal myConnection As PgSqlConnection)
  Dim cmd As New PgSqlCommand("SELECT * FROM Test.AllTypes")
  cmd.Connection = myConnection
  myConnection.Open()
  Try
    Dim reader As PgSqlDataReader = cmd.ExecuteReader
    reader.Read()
    Dim recievedDouble As Double = reader.GetDouble(reader.GetOrdinal("DoubleCol"))
    reader.Close()
  Finally
    myConnection.Close()
  End Try
End Sub
See Also